I’ve completed payment by woocommerce plugin, everything in NowPayments panel is success, i received tokens but status of my Order not changing (Pending Payment). I setup plugin with my api key and IPN secret corectly. Please help
]]>By default customers can pay in a simply vast number of different cryptocurrency coins.
But surely only a handful will be used for most transactions. Surely some coins are worth more than others. What if a customer pays with a cryptocurrency only used by 2 people in the whole world? Surely you would want to stop that happening. Or will such currencies have bad exchange rates?
Could you provide an option to allow users with one click to select the 5 or 10 most used coins? It will save ages trying to unselect tens of different coins.
]]>I’m unsure if I did everything correctly but here are the steps I followed:
So looks like everything was setup correctly…but I’m not 100% sure.
I’m testing buying something. When I choose Nonpayments it opens a new URL that asks me to choose the asset. No matter what asset I choose it shows “ailed to create payment” when I click next and I can’t do anything else.
I’m not sure what I’m missing here or what I need to do.
Looks like I also have an error in my logs:
[03-Jul-2024 20:43:20 UTC] PHP Fatal error: Uncaught TypeError: array_key_exists(): Argument #2 ($array) must be of type array, null given in /home/previtusmedia/domains/previtusmedia.com/public_html/wp-content/plugins/nowpayments-for-woocommerce/includes/class-gateway.php:224
Stack trace: 0 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/class-wp-hook.php(324): NPWC_Gateway->ipn_callback() 1 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() 2 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/plugin.php(517): WP_Hook->do_action() 3 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-content/plugins/woocommerce-legacy-rest-api/includes/class-wc-api.php(150): do_action() 4 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/class-wp-hook.php(324): WC_API->handle_api_requests() 5 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/class-wp-hook.php(348): WP_Hook->apply_filters() 6 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/plugin.php(565): WP_Hook->do_action() 7 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/class-wp.php(418): do_action_ref_array() 8 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/class-wp.php(813): WP->parse_request() 9 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-includes/functions.php(1336): WP->main() 10 /home/previtusmedia/domains/previtusmedia.com/public_html/wp-blog-header.php(16): wp() 11 /home/previtusmedia/domains/previtusmedia.com/public_html/index.php(17): require(‘…’) 12 {main}
thrown in /home/previtusmedia/domains/previtusmedia.com/public_html/wp-content/plugins/nowpayments-for-woocommerce/includes/class-gateway.php on line 224
]]>Hello everyone.
I found that the two plugins “NOWPayments” and “CryptoPay WooCommerce,” are not compatible with each other. Whenever I activate the NOWPayments plugin, it triggers an error that affects several other plugins on my website. I have attached an image that shows the error message for your reference.
Error:
Warning: Undefined array key “slug” in /home/ieltsnob/public_html/wp-content/plugins/nowpayments-for-woocommerce/includes/class-npwc-init.php on line 140
hi there when i want to complete order after redirection your website shows cloudflare message: “Web server is returning an unknown error?Error code 520”
please solve the problem
]]>FastCGI sent in stderr: “PHP message: PHP Warning: Undefined array key “slug” in /var/www/dev.local/htdocs/wp-content/plugins/nowpayments-for-woocommerce/includes/class-npwc-init.php on line 140
Please help
]]>Hello,
Thank for share plugin.
But i test plugin.
Order has been completed. But status order in WooCommerce show [Pending payment] NOT change to [Completed]